Output cc31a7581b89aa6c99694d7c23ac05c53c0eec2e67d7b3ae51081450178f6072:38

value
43500000
script pubkey
OP_0 OP_PUSHBYTES_20 fdf4112b72525a57c17e955e5324c24135d75fb8
address
ltc1qlh6pz2mj2fd90st7j409xfxzgy6awhac9wfcx2
transaction
cc31a7581b89aa6c99694d7c23ac05c53c0eec2e67d7b3ae51081450178f6072
spent
false